TEACHING EXPERIENCE

I have over ten years of teaching experience at the middle school level. I’ve spent my career enthusiastically teaching English Language Arts, Reading and Writing Lab, Creative Writing, British Literature, and Social Studies. I have had the opportunity to teach internationally in Belize, England, and Africa. Leadership opportunities have allowed me to train and mentor teachers implementing programming and instruction. I’m passionate about instruction. In fact, I’ve had the opportunity to originate a Step Ahead Summer Program, an elective Creating Writing course, interdisciplanary curriculum for the Regional Summer School Program, and I even proposed, created, and implemented a Reading and Writing Lab course that was adopted school-wide to address students’ academic needs.

MY TEACHING STYLE

My teaching philosophy is all about creating engaging learning environments and differentiated instruction to maximize student achievement and learning. I believe in creating challenging and rigorous lesson plans that can be delivered in positive and fun ways so that students can find joy in learning.
